Albumin: Instrument

1. This document provides the application parameters and instrument settings for measuring albumin levels using a spectrophotometric bromocresol green method on an ARCHITECT C8000 instrument. 2. The reagent is ready to use and measures albumin levels in a range of 0.0-70.0 g/L using a single wavelength of 628/700 nm with a reading time of 7-9 seconds. 3. Calibration is done using a linear method with a single calibrator at a concentration to be determined by the user and run in triplicates every 999 hours or full interval.
